Word origin C12: from the phrase for the nonce , a mistaken division of for then anes, literally: for the once, from then dative singular of the + anes once According to the Cambridge Dictionary, “ nonce ” is a slang term used in the U.K. to describe someone who is accused of a sex crime. It is primarily used to describe someone involved in a crime... In its simplest definition, this is a British slang term that means "pedophile." The Cambridge Dictionary, spelling it " nonce ," defines it as "a person who commits a crime involving sex ...
